研究人员开发了一种生物灵感的电化学神经形态装置 (BEND),使用了一种新的 thienoviologen 电解质. 这种新材料可以实现高效的神经形态计算,模仿高级人工智能应用中的大脑功能.

背景情况:
- 神经形态计算旨在复制生物神经网络,需要先进的材料和设备设计.
- 现有的神经形态设备在稳定性,可调性和模仿复杂的突触功能方面面临挑战.
研究的目的:
- 为了引入一个新的生物启发电化学神经形态装置 (BEND) 基于一个 thienoviologen 电解质.
- 评估设备在图像识别方面的性能及其模拟突触功能的能力.
主要方法:
- 使用基于 thienoviologen 的电解质制造 BEND,通过修改 thiophene 组 (ThV2+) 来修改 viologen.
- 测试设备的稳定性,电压刺激下的导电性可调性,以及集成到卷积神经网络 (CNN) 中.
- 评估突触功能的模拟,如峰值时间依赖可塑性 (STDP) 和帕夫洛夫式学习.
主要成果:
- 丁诺维奥根电解质显示能耗差距减少,稳定性增强,电化学活性改善.
- 该BEND显示出极好的环境稳定性和可调节的导电性.
- 在CNN中使用时,在时尚-MNIST数据集上实现了近80%的准确性,并成功模仿了STDP和Pavlovian学习.
结论:
- 基于 thienoviologen 的材料为神经形态电子提供了重要的潜力.
- 该BEND设备扩大了viologen材料的功能能力,用于人工突触.
- 为下一代电化学人工突触提供了新的设计原则.
